ASSP member Abby Ferri, CSP, has received the International Safety Equipment Association (ISEA) Robert B. Hurley Distinguished Service Award. The award recognizes individuals whose efforts have advanced and promoted workplace safety and health.
"The Distinguished Service Award is reserved for an outstanding individual who has made significant contributions to the advancement and promotion of workplace safety and health," says Charles Johnson, ISEA president. "Over her safety career, Abby Ferri has shown an unwavering commitment and deep passion for worker safety, and is known as a practical and creative safety professional, with innovative ways to communicate the importance of keeping workers safe."
Ferri has more than 16 years' experience in the field of safety and health in diverse industries including construction, manufacturing, healthcare, hospitality, beverage and retail. She is President of our Northwest Chapter and Administrator of the Women in Safety Excellence Common Interest Group. She is also a member of the Construction, Consultants and Risk Management/Insurance practice specialties.
